Pros

- Solid sales training - Fully remote - Solid benefits - Good place to get a few months of experience and then land something better; I saw it as an exhausting paid job search

Cons

- Terrible base pay - Selling terrible product (former clients universally despise it) - You won't earn commission until a few months in (they do this cute thing where you don't "unlock" commission until you book $12k in revenue) - Good luck living on $600 a week-- might as well bartend and have time to apply for a job that actually pays a living wage - Constantly hiring and firing a ton of people - Cringey, culty "culture" - Prepare to be micromanaged-- they chew you out if you go longer than ten minutes without dialing. But they encourage you to do a whole bunch of crap like listen in on past calls. Am I supposed to do this in my free time? Yeah, ok. I have a life. - Constantly ramming propaganda down your throat about how good the commission checks are gonna be (you know, one day)
